Animal rights group sues Perhilitan over culling of endangered monkeys
ADS

A 28-year-old individual and animal rights group Pertubuhan Hak Asasi Hidupan Liar Malaysia (Hidup) have filed a suit against the Wildlife and National Parks Department (Perhilitan) and Energy and Natural Resources Minister Shamsul Anuar Nasarah over the culling of dusky leaf monkeys two months ago.

The case was filed in the Seremban High Court over the allegation that Perhilitan officers had killed 20 of the endangered monkeys at Taman Raja Zainal, Port Dickson on May 19.
